Need a gluten free, dairy free, and primal main course? Basil Shrimp Salad could be a great recipe to try. This recipe serves 6. One serving contains 169 calories, 32g of protein, and 2g of fat. A mixture of to 6 tomatoes, celery, green onions, and a handful of other ingredients are all it takes to make this recipe so yummy. From preparation to the plate, this recipe takes around 20 minutes.

Recommended wine: Pinot Grigio, Riesling, Sauvignon Blanc

Shrimp works really well with Pinot Grigio, Riesling, and Sauvignon Blanc. These crisp white wines work well with shrimp prepared in a variety of ways, whether grilled, fried, or in garlic sauce.
